Worship Helps for Pentecost 8
Artwork: Parable of the Good Samaritan Artist: Jan Wijnants Date: 1670 Worship Theme: The believer loves his neighbor. We have every reason to love him. We know what we were when God found us; we know the love and mercy he poured out on us. Christ, the compassion of God, has treated our spiritual wounds and paid for our healing with his own blood. As we have known his goodness, let us do good to all. As our Prayer of the Day reminds us: The word is planted in our hearts, and now we ask the Holy Spirit to bring forth such fruits of faith as loving our neighbor for the sake of Christ.
